Bolesław Proch (4 February 1952 – 22 December 2012) was a Polish international motorcycle speedway rider who was Polish Junior Champion in 1974.
Early life and career
Born in Świebodzin, Proch first rode for Falubaz in his home town of Zielona Góra in 1973, winning the Polish Junior Championship the following year and finishing fourth in the Silver Helmet tournament. In 1976 he rode in the British League for Reading Racers, averaging over five points per match. In 1977 he moved to Leicester Lions mid-season in a deal that saw Doug Underwood moving to Reading.
He returned to Poland where he rode for Stal Gorzów Wielkopolski (1977-1980) and Polonia Bydgoszcz (1981-1987).
